For one it starts to change the perception that KU is not a one trick pony. That's all everyone thinks about KU. It's a basketball school. That's it. We need the volleyball team, football team, baseball team etc to get much better so other conferences see there are multiple reasons to add us.
The Big Ten already has good basketball teams, why do they want to add another school that is only good at hoops? We need to get better at other things to change the way our peers look at us. Having espn3 as a platform should help our coaches in recruiting. That in turn should have a trickle down effect into more of our programs getting better. Being competitive in multiple sports can do nothing but help KU's positioning should realignment come back. That is why it is important that the volleyball team continues to do well and football improves and baseball gets better and and and.
By the way, the Big Ten takes volleyball serious. If you want KU to go there you should know this. They are historically a very good conference in volleyball. Currently 8 of the top 25 schools in that sport are from the Big Ten.
